Car
If you're traveling by car, navigate to Velké Karlovice, which is the nearest town to Beskyd. From the center of Velké Karlovice, head northeast on the main road towards the direction of the Beskids mountains. Follow the signs for 'Beskyd' for approximately 10 km. You'll pass through beautiful landscapes and have the option to stop at various scenic viewpoints along the way. There are no tolls on this route, but be mindful of the speed limits in residential areas.
Public Transportation (Bus)
To reach Beskyd via public transportation, take a bus from a nearby city or town to Velké Karlovice. Buses frequently run from cities like Zlín and Vsetín. Upon arrival at the Velké Karlovice bus station, you can take a local taxi or a shuttle service to Beskyd. The cost of the bus ticket varies by distance but expect to pay around 100-200 CZK. Local taxis may charge around 300-500 CZK to reach Beskyd from the bus station, depending on the distance.
Hiking
For adventurous travelers, hiking is a viable option if you're already in the vicinity of Beskyd. Follow the marked hiking trails from Velké Karlovice, which lead directly into the Beskyd mountain range. Ensure you have a good map or a GPS device, as the trails can be quite rugged. This hike typically takes about 2-3 hours, depending on your pace. Make sure to wear appropriate footwear and bring water and snacks. This option is free of charge, but be cautious of the weather.
